31 Mar 1975, Prek Phnov, Cambodia --- 3/31/1975- Prek Phnou, Cambodia- Young Cambodian girls take up defensive positions in home at Prek Phnou, some 6 miles north of Phnom Penh's Higway 5. Meanwhile, government sources said 3/31 that President Lon Nol will leave Cambodia sometime this week, probably for good. Heavy shelling attacks were reported at the Mekong River enclave of Neak Luong and nearby outpost at Banam, 130 miles south of Phnom Penh.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
31 Mar 1975, Prek Phnov, Cambodia --- Prek Phnau, Cambodia: Homeless Cambodian orphans sit idle while waiting for their turn to receive a bowl of cooked-rice at a refugee camp here 6 miles north of the Cambodian capital March 31. The American airlift of good and other supplies continue to operate despite pre-dawn rocket attacks by the communists at the airport.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S

Phnom Penh, Cambodia: President Ford sent White House photographer David Hume Kennerly to Vietnam and Cambodia to assess the situation and take pictures of what he saw. The White House released pictures of Cambodian refugees, April 6. Taken March 29, 1975, a Cambodian girl waits in a refugee center, wearing a dog-tag as a trinket. March 29, 1975. --- Image by David Kennerly/CORBIS
29 Mar 1975, Phnom Penh, Cambodia --- Phnom Penh, Cambodia: President Ford sent his personal photographer, David Hume Kennerly, to Vietnam and Cambodia to assess the situation. The White House released pictures, April 6, of what he saw. Here is a Cambodian child suffering from malnutrition in a Phnom Penh hospital, March 29.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
3/26/1975-Phnom Penh, Cambodia- A badly wounded mother, hurt in rebel rocket attack, continues to nurse her baby while being evacuated aboard Navy boat from Vhang War Island in Mekong River. Communist-led rebels captured a strategic stretch of riverfront two miles north of Phnom Penh 3/26, advancing the closest ever to the Cambodian capital.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
08 Apr 1975, Prek Phnov, Cambodia --- Much Needed Food. Prek Phnau, Cambodia: Children in this war-torn country reach out for their portion of rice from Red Cross worker here some 3.6 miles from the capital.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
4/2/75-Phnom Penh, Cambodia: A woman holds her child, who was wounded during a rocket attack on Phnom Penh by communist-led insurgents March 24.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S

25 May 1970, Hanoi, North Vietnam --- Hanoi, North Vietnam: A fifteen member delegation of the National United Government of royal Kampuchea arrived in Hanoi. From left: North Vietnamese premier Pham Van Dong; royal Kampuchea's Premier Penn Nouth; North Vietnamese president Ton Duc Thang; and Prince Norodom Sihanouk of Kampuchea inspect the honor guard upon arrival. --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
25 May 1970, Hanoi, North Vietnam --- Hanoi, North Vietnam: Prince Norodom Sihanouk waves his hand during his arrival in Hanoi. At his right is North Vietnamese premier Pham Van Dong. Also seen is Premier Penn Nouth and North Vietnamese defense minister Vo Nguyen Giap (wearing helmet). --- Image by Bettmann/CORBIS
